Unilever--yet another private equity target?(FINANCIAL NEWS)
Cosmetics International, March, 2007
The private equity talk isn't just stopping at Alliance-Boots. According to City analysts, consumer goods giant Unilever could also be in the frame of the private equity hawks.
Last week Unilever's share price rose on market chatter of a takeover bid. 'All bets are now off," said Graham Neale, head of equities at Killik Stockbrokers. "There's a lot of speculation going on out there and Unilever could be a target." Neale points to the recent announcement by Cadbury Schweppes that it will split its confectionery and soft drinks business. In other words, despite its size, Unilever could be next for a private equity bid.
Unilever recently launched a buy-back programme worth up to 1.5bn [euro]. The maker of Dove and Sunsilk also recently got a re-rating...
